Silver klister rocks!

Spent Mon-Wed morning skiing from Crystal to Nachese pass.  I would have gone to Stampede Pass but I could not manage a stable field repair on the top of three screws holding my binding.  Heavy new and heavier old snow made for slow but manageable trail breaking and High avy conditions.  Silver klister worked better than I expected once the new snow surface warmed up to 35 deg. F.

Jenny Osborne accompanied me to nearly Norse Pk before cutting up the hill back to the car where she cell phoned me an "all clear". 


Snow summary:
We did not hear any Whoomphing untill we hit small cup-bowls on the crest or E (leeward) aspects.
The slope cuts I performed on and near cornices resulted in long tracked avalanches that stepped down from 4" deep to 10" deep and usualy ran down to the next bench gathering lots of snow en route.


Monday night the drizzle turned to 4" of new snow overnight at 4K ft.  6" total new was observed Mon-Tue a.m. near Naches Pass at about 5K ft.

Skiiable snow ended abruptly at about mile post 14 on F.S. rd 70 above Pyramid Pk snow park.
Looks like the Gate to Hwy 123/410 Cayuse Pass is open.  Rumor has it Chinook may open this wk-end.  This work must be what we heard on Monday that starteled us so.
